The first Tuesday of every month is Public Domain Movie Night at Bierock.On Tuesday June 4, Bierock will pay homage to Roger Corman with a screening of Little Shop of Horrors.
The recently deceased Corman directed the comedic horror film from 1960 that has an enduring legacy.
The brief synopsis from Turner Classic Movies sets the scene…
"A clumsy young man nurtures a bloodthirsty plant that forces him to K*ll to feed it."
Movie start time is at 8:00 p.m. Admission is free and open to the public.
Bierock’s full food and drink menu are available the night of the event.
Located at 2911 N. Sherman Ave., Bierock is part of the Northside TownCenter and across the street from Warner Park.
